“Tennessee is where I want to be, and I always wanted to be there at the end of the day,” said Williams, who’s ranked by 247Sports as the nation’s No. 20 overall prospect and No. 1 wide receiver in the 2015 class. “That’s my school, my family.” The 6-foot-4, 190-pound Williams visited Clemson, Florida, Georgia and Auburn within a span of less than five weeks in February and March, and he said at the time that he was “still open” but “still committed” to Tennessee. But he admitted that he recently had been thinking “for a while” about closing the door on other schools, and he finally decided to take that step last week. “Tennessee was my favorite school growing up,” Williams said. “When I first went there, I kind of got a good vibe off of it. I feel comfortable there, and it’s somewhere I can play for the next four years.


quote:

“I knew I wanted to be there at the end of the day.” Williams said it doesn’t hurt that his fiancee’s decision to enroll at Tennessee this fall is now “final,” and that’s at least “part” of the reason he chose to shut down his recruitment.
